Description
For an unknown reason, humanity was here.
Trials that mimicked history, replaying it as if taunting those in the future that they will make the same mistake. Forces beyond what should and shouldn't exist, exert their influence on the mundane. Yet not all hope was lost, despite being subjected to the worst possible conditions for any living being, humanity has adapted.
Yet times have changed, and humanity has found itself at a bottleneck, unable to continue forward anymore. Faced with a choice, a certain maiden had chosen the radical route. Sacrificing herself all of humanity's progress to forcefully evolve its talent.
From these seeds that she had sown, it was only a matter of time before the wall they faced crumbled apart.
Unfortunately, one of these seeds was rotten. Just what kind of chaos would this unruly seed incite? Would his existence be a benefit or a detriment to humanity?
See how a young man named Arin, fueled with the desire to trample over everyone else, lives alongside those who were meant for greatness. At first, he had felt immense joy ruling over everyone else, continually suppressing any resistance. Then, as time passed, he learned that others were stronger, more talented, more skilled, and even more impressive than he would ever be.
Just how far was he willing to keep up with the monsters he had once dominated?

- HaracasRoyal Road★★ 2.0I dont think ive ever read a novel with such a gaping disparity between its prologue and main story.
Grammar is decent, nothing amazing but without errors, but thats about the only passable thing this novel has going for it.
The style is the greatest issue for me. Everything moves so slow because firstly this novel suffers from the 'telling and not showing' syndrome. About 90% of this novel is exposition. We are told what characters feel, what they think, why they do. This is exacerbated by the excrutiangly slow moments of action where every characters actions, thoughts and reactions are told to us in detail. And at the end we are left with a two thousand word scene for what is a brief scuffle.
The story as a consequence suffers, but as an added layer of deterence for readers, most of the plot points so far have involved insignificant matters. Why do I care to read about a school fight when i know next to nothing about the world or how the power system works? And its not like these are short scenes, they take up 4 whole chapters. Thats twelve thousand words i dont care one bit about.
Lastly the characters. Oh boy, where do I begin. Let me preface this with saying I pretty much exclusively read stories with evil mcs, so when I say this mc is beyond edgy to the degree hes unlikable, know that its really bad. I dont know how a character thats unironically this edgy comes to be and its not like hes even consistent. At home hes a totally different person and not because hes doing it intentionally. We are just meant to accept that a dude who regularly beats people to near death cause hes bored can function like a regular kid at home. No chance. The other characters arent much to talk about either and are very generic cutouts of the usual tropes.
If there is any advice I can give it would be to reduce the amount of waffle and words salad. Focus the story around the important events and not whats in between. And for the love of god, please tone down the edge.
